Carthay
Population
- 4,866 population in 2000, according to the U.S. Census
- 5,120 population in 2008, based on L.A. Department of City Planning estimates.
- 0.50 square miles
- 9,642 people per square mile, about average for the city of Los Angeles and about average for the county
Ethnicity
- The percentage of black people is high for the county.
- Highly diverse for the city of Los Angeles and highly diverse for the county
Income
- $71,398 median household income (2008 dollars), high for the city of Los Angeles but about average for the county
- In Los Angeles County, Studio City, Lake Hughes and Northridge have the most similar household incomes.
- The percentage of households earning $125,000 and up is high for the county.
Education
- 53.2% of residents 25 and older have a four-year degree, high for the city of Los Angeles and high for the county
- In Los Angeles County, Windsor Square, Stevenson Ranch and Encino have the nearest percentage of residents 25 and older with a four-year degree.
- The percentages of residents 25 and older with a bachelor's degree and a master's degree or higher are high for the county.
Age
- The median age is 37, old for the city of Los Angeles and old for the county
- In Los Angeles County, Acton, Agoura Hills and Altadena have similar median ages.
- The percentages of residents ages 35 to 49, 65 and older and 19 to 34 are among the county's highest.

Families
- The percentages of widowed females, never married males, never married females and divorced females are among the county's highest.
- There are 142 families headed by single parents. The rate is 13.6%, about average for the city of Los Angeles and about average for the county
Military
- There are 168 veterans, or 4.1% of the population, low for the city of Los Angeles and low for the county overall
- The percentage of veterans who served during WWII or Korea is among the county's highest.
Ancestry and immigration
- Mexican (9.3%) and Russian (8.6%) are the most common ancestries.
- 1,221 (25.1%) of residents are foreign born, low for the city of Los Angeles but about average for the county. Mexico (26.4%) and Korea (8.2%) are the most common foreign places of birth.
Carthay
is a neighborhood in the city of Los Angeles in the Central L.A. region of Los Angeles County. It contains Carthay Circle, Carthay Square and South Carthay.
The neighboring communities are Beverly Grove, Beverly Hills, Mid-City, Mid-Wilshire and Pico-Robertson.
